How much do gmp consultant jobs pay per hour?

As of Aug 7, 2026, the average hourly pay for gmp consultant in the United States is $66.73,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$55.53 and $80.77 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

Are GMP consultant jobs in demand?

GMP (Good Manufacturing Practice) consultant jobs are in demand due to ongoing regulatory requirements in the pharmaceutical, biotech, and food industries. Professionals with expertise in compliance, quality assurance, and relevant certifications are sought after to ensure manufacturing processes meet strict standards.

What is a GMP consultant?

A GMP (Good Manufacturing Practice) Consultant is a professional who helps businesses comply with regulatory standards for the production of pharmaceuticals, medical devices, food, and cosmetics. They assist in quality assurance, regulatory compliance, audits, and process improvements to ensure safety, consistency, and legal adherence. Their role often includes training staff, identifying compliance gaps, and preparing companies for inspections by regulatory bodies like the FDA or EMA.

What does a GMP consultant do?

A GMP Consultant’s daily responsibilities often include conducting facility audits, reviewing and developing SOPs, analyzing compliance gaps, and providing recommendations for process improvements. They may also deliver training sessions to staff, ensure documentation aligns with regulatory standards, and support client teams during inspections or regulatory submissions. GMP Consultants frequently collaborate with quality assurance, production, and regulatory affairs personnel, making strong interpersonal skills and clear communication crucial. This diverse mix of tasks provides opportunities to solve challenges and help organizations maintain high-quality standards.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a GMP consultant?

To thrive as a GMP Consultant, you need in-depth knowledge of Good Manufacturing Practices, quality assurance, and regulatory compliance, typically backed by a degree in life sciences or related fields. Familiarity with regulatory frameworks (such as FDA, EMA), audit processes, and systems like CAPA management or electronic QMS is essential, and certifications like GMP Professional or Six Sigma are advantageous. Strong analytical thinking, project management, and excellent communication skills are key soft skills for excelling in this role. These abilities ensure consultants can effectively guide organizations through complex regulatory landscapes, drive continuous improvement, and maintain compliance within highly regulated industries.

How to become a GMP consultant?

To become a GMP (Good Manufacturing Practice) consultant, individuals typically need a background in life sciences, pharmacy, or engineering, along with experience in pharmaceutical or biotech manufacturing. Obtaining certifications such as the Certified Quality Auditor or GMP-specific training can enhance credibility, and strong knowledge of regulatory requirements from agencies like the FDA is essential. Gaining practical experience and staying current with industry standards are key steps in establishing a career as a GMP consultant.

Job Overview

We are seeking an experienced GMP QC Systems Consultant to support the implementation, integration, and validation of Quality Control laboratory systems in a regulated pharmaceutical environment. The ideal candidate will have strong expertise in GMP laboratory systems, Computer System Validation (CSV/CSA), and cross-functional project execution.

Key Responsibilities

  • Lead implementation and integration of GMP QC laboratory systems.
  • Coordinate system configuration, data migration, deployment, and go-live activities.
  • Manage project timelines, risks, budgets, and stakeholder communications.
  • Support Computer System Validation (CSV/CSA), including IQ/OQ/PQ execution and documentation.
  • Perform risk assessments, testing, and validation activities in compliance with GAMP5 and GxP requirements.
  • Collaborate with QA, IT, laboratory teams, vendors, and business stakeholders to ensure successful project delivery.
  • Ensure compliance with GxP, Data Integrity, and internal quality standards.
  • Prepare project status reports and support release readiness activities.

Required Qualifications

  • 8+ years of experience in Pharmaceutical, Biotechnology, or other GMP-regulated environments.
  • Strong experience implementing and validating QC/Laboratory systems.
  • Hands-on knowledge of CSV, CSA, GAMP5, GxP, IQ/OQ/PQ, and risk-based validation.
  • Experience with system integration, data migration, and cross-functional project coordination.
  • Familiarity with laboratory platforms such as LIMS, SDMS, Empower, LabX, QuantStudio, SoftMax Pro, or similar systems.
  • Excellent communication, documentation, and stakeholder management skills.
